Bhopal (Madhya Pradesh): Chief Minister Mohan Yadav had a meeting with Home Minister Amit Shah in Varanasi on Tuesday after he met Prime Minister Narendra Modi in New Delhi on Monday.
Yadav participated in a conference of the Central Regional Council in Varanasi.
Earlier, Yadav held talks with Shah at a dinner on Monday. According to sources, Yadav informed Shah about the development works done in the past few months in the state.
Urban Development Minister Kailash Vijayvargiya was invited to the Central Regional Council meeting for the first time. Chief Secretary Anurag Jain also took part in it.
The issues of malnutrition, the IT sector and rural development figured at the conference.
There was a presentation of important works being done by the state government.
Yadav wrote on social media X that the conference focused on coordination among the states and various dimensions of development, security, health and tourism, which will translate Prime Minister Narendra Modi’s dreams of a developed India into reality.
